About 262725 PIN Code

The PIN code 262725 belongs to Banika in Uttar Pradesh, India. It serves 6 locations and is administered by the Uttar Pradesh Circle of India Post.

262725 is part of the Kheri district and Lakhimpur taluka / block. Use this PIN code when sending mail, parcels or registered post to addresses in this area. For neighbouring areas, please check the related pincodes shown below.

What is the difference between branch type and division?

The branch type (BO = Branch Office, SO = Sub Office, HO = Head Office) describes the post office hierarchy, while the division and circle are administrative groupings under India Post.
